What is Derived Embodiment?
Derived embodiment refers to the association of abstract concepts with our bodily experiences. It suggests that our understanding of abstract ideas relies heavily on the activation of sensorimotor experiences associated with our physical actions and sensations. While concrete language use is often linked to immediate sensory experiences, derived embodiment explores the way in which our minds bridge the gap between the abstract and the physical.
For instance, when we say "feeling down" to express sadness or depression, we are metaphorically linking a physical experience (i.e., being physically lower) with an abstract emotional state. Derived embodiment suggests that our comprehension of this metaphor involves the activation of sensorimotor experiences associated with being physically low, such as a drooping posture or downward-directed gaze.

The Cognitive Mechanisms Behind Derived Embodiment
Derived embodiment relies on the activation of various cognitive mechanisms that allow us to bridge the gap between the abstract and the concrete. Let's explore some of these mechanisms:
Metaphorical Mapping
One key mechanism behind derived embodiment is the use of metaphorical mapping. Metaphors enable us to understand and express abstract concepts by mapping them onto more concrete, sensorimotor experiences. For example, when we say "time flies," we are mapping the abstract concept of time onto the concrete experience of a flying object. This mapping allows us to grasp the fleeting nature of time in a more tangible way.
Simulation and Embodied Cognition
Simulation and embodied cognition play a vital role in derived embodiment. Simulation involves mentally simulating sensorimotor experiences related to a concept, allowing us to understand it more comprehensively. For example, when we read a passage describing a character running, our minds simulate the experience of running, facilitating our understanding of the narrative.
Embodied cognition takes this a step further by suggesting that our bodily experiences and sensations play a significant role in our cognitive processes. Through embodied cognition, derived embodiment connects bodily experiences to abstract ideas. This connection contributes to our ability to comprehend and express abstract concepts through language.
The Influence of Derived Embodiment on Language Use
Derived embodiment significantly influences the way we use language, shaping our choice of words and expressions. Let's explore some aspects of language use impacted by derived embodiment:
Metaphorical Language
Metaphors are a prominent feature of language, and derived embodiment underlies their effectiveness. By linking abstract concepts with concrete experiences, metaphors make the abstract more accessible and relatable. We often use metaphors unconsciously, relying on derived embodiment to enhance our communication.
Gestures and Body Language
Derived embodiment extends beyond spoken words and encompasses gestures and body language as well. Our physical movements and expressions play a crucial role in conveying abstract ideas. For example, raising our hands in a defensive posture can signify disagreement, even without verbalizing it. This interplay between bodily experiences and language is a testament to the power of derived embodiment.
The Implications of Derived Embodiment
The concept of derived embodiment has profound implications for various fields, including psychology, linguistics, and neurology. By understanding the cognitive processes involved in derived embodiment, we gain insights into how our minds process and represent abstract concepts.
In the realm of education, derived embodiment can inform teaching techniques, enabling educators to enhance students' comprehension and retention of abstract ideas. Techniques such as incorporating physical gestures or providing metaphorical analogies can tap into derived embodiment, facilitating learning in a more holistic and engaging manner.
Furthermore, the study of derived embodiment has implications for individuals with language impairments or neurological conditions. Understanding how derived embodiment influences language processing can aid in developing targeted therapies or interventions to alleviate communication difficulties and enhance linguistic abilities.
Derived embodiment in abstract language illuminates the intricate relationship between our physical experiences and our comprehension of abstract ideas. By bridging the gap between the concrete and the abstract, derived embodiment plays a crucial role in our linguistic abilities and communication strategies. Understanding the cognitive mechanisms behind derived embodiment can help us further unravel the complexities of language processing, leading to advancements in education, therapy, and our overall understanding of the human mind.

How does knowledge of phenomena and events we have no direct experiences of emerge? Having a brain that learns from being in the world, how can we conceive of prehistoric dinosaurs, Atlantis, unicorns or even ‘desire’? This book is about how abstract knowledge becomes anchored in direct experiences through well-formed conversations.
Within the framework of evolutionary biology and through the lens of contemporary studies in cognitive science, the neurosciences, sociology and anthropology, this book traces topics such as our inborn sensitivity to the environment, bottom-up and top-down processes in knowledge formation and the importance of language when we learn to categorise the world.
A major objective of this monograph is to identify the key determinants of the specific interactivity mechanisms that control the cognitive processes while we are linguistically immersed. The emphasis is on real-life interactions in conversations. While the concrete word-object paradigm depends relatively more on direct experiences, the successful acquisition of abstract knowledge depends on the emphatic skills of the interlocutor. He or she must remain sensitive to the level and quality of the imagination of the child while making mental tableaus that are believed to elicit images to which the child associates the concept.
Derived embodiment in abstract thought is a landmark synthesis that operationalizes contemporary neuroscience studies of acquisition of knowledge in the real life conversational context. The result is an exciting biology-based contribution to theories of knowledge acquisition and thinking in sociology, cognitive robotics, anthropology and not at least, pedagogy.
